Cleaning Performance

The JXIAA Cordless Pressure Washer delivers a maximum pressure of 1880 PSI and a flow rate of 3.0 GPM, providing a solid cleaning performance for various surfaces, including vehicles and outdoor furniture. In contrast, the Westinghouse attachment can reach pressures up to 4400 PSI, making it significantly more powerful when used with compatible pressure washers. This difference translates to quicker and more efficient cleaning, especially for larger flat surfaces like driveways and patios.

Portability and Usability

The JXIAA is designed for easy portability, featuring a lightweight build and a 32 ft detachable hose that allows users to draw water from various sources, including buckets or pools. This makes it ideal for outdoor use in areas without direct access to a water faucet. On the other hand, the Westinghouse attachment, while not standalone, is simple to use with a 1/4" quick-connect fitting, making it compatible with most gas and electric pressure washers. However, it lacks the same level of portability as the JXIAA since it requires an existing pressure washer to operate.

Versatility in Cleaning Tasks

The JXIAA includes a 6-in-1 nozzle and a foam cannon, providing versatility for different cleaning tasks. Users can easily switch between spray patterns to accommodate various surfaces and mess levels, making it suitable for everything from gentle rinsing to heavy-duty cleaning. The Westinghouse attachment, while specialized for flat surfaces, may not offer the same adaptability. It is primarily designed for horizontal and vertical cleaning of larger areas, which could limit its use in more detailed cleaning scenarios.

Battery Life vs. Power Source

The JXIAA features a rechargeable battery that enables it to operate without a direct power source, providing freedom of movement during cleaning tasks. This battery is designed for full cleaning sessions, making it convenient for those who may be away from outlets. Conversely, the Westinghouse attachment relies entirely on being paired with a gas or electric pressure washer for its power, which may restrict its usability in remote locations without access to electricity or fuel.
